    Gestational Diabetes Mellitus, A1

    Carbohydrate intolerance first diagnosed during pregnancy. Diagnosis from abnormal oral glucose tolerance test (OGTT) but normal glucose levels when fasting and two hours post-prandial. Euglycemia achieved with diet and/or exercise. (NCI Thesaurus)
